Marshall Bennett Islands are several islands in Milne Bay and considered part of Papua New Guinea. They consist of. Gawa, the main island; Dugumenu; Iwa Island

Abstract:
Disclosed are compositions that include a dispersion of inorganic nanocylinders in lyotropic liquid crystalline form. The inorganic nanocylinders have a high aspect ratio and are highly aligned.

Adsorption Processes And Systems Utilizing Step Lift Control Of Hydraulically Actuated Poppet Valves

Abstract:
A valve installation is provided, including a valve assembly having a valve, and a fluidized valve actuator coupled with the valve assembly. The actuator includes at least two cylinders and pistons positioned to communicate fluid to apply pressure to the valve assembly. Extension of each piston communicates pressure to the valve assembly and at least partially lifts the valve into an at least partially lifted and open position. The valve installation may be used to regulate fluid flow in various systems, including cyclical swing adsorption processes.

Apparatus And System For Swing Adsorption Processes Related Thereto

Provided are apparatus and systems for performing a swing adsorption process. This swing adsorption process may involve passing an input feed stream through two swing adsorption systems as a purge stream to remove contaminants, such as water, from the respective adsorbent bed units. The wet purge product stream is passed to a solvent based gas treating system, which forms a wet hydrocarbon rich stream and a wet acid gas stream. Then, the wet hydrocarbon rich stream and the wet acid gas stream are passed through one of the respective swing adsorption systems to remove some of the moisture from the respective wet streams.
